Re: How do I make custom splash screens?
By: Logic44 to All on Tue Jan 20 2026 03:42 am
> How do I make or acquire a custom splash screen? (The screen that appears
> after login)
Synchronet comes with stock logon screens as files in text/menu, named either
logon.* or random*.*. You simply add, edit, or replace those files. For
refernce:
https://wiki.synchro.net/custom:menu_files
> I'm new to this whole sysop thing and I'm wondering how all the advanced
> stuff works, the only thing I've really done for the server so far is get it
> up and on the public internet...
As for customizing the look and feel of a Synchronet BBS, this would be a good
place to start: https://wiki.synchro.net/custom:index
